Fixes & Enhancements

Fixes:
- For ME9.x-11.x with vPro supported platforms:
Updated Intel ME Firmware to address security advisories INTEL-SA-00112 (CVE-2018-3628 CVE-2018-3629 CVE-2018-3632 ) & INTEL-SA-00118(CVE-2018-3627)
- For ME11.x with non-vPro supported platforms: (CSMB and BC non-vPro supported platforms)
Updated Intel ME Firmware to address security advisory INTEL-SA-00118(CVE-2018-3627)
- Updated CPU microcode to address security advisory Intel Security Advisory INTEL-SA-00115 (CVE-2018-3639 & CVE-2018-3640)

Run the BIOS update utility from a Windows environment
1. Browse to the location where you downloaded the file and double-click the new file.
2. Windows will auto restart and update the BIOS at the system startup screen.
3. After the BIOS update is complete, the system will auto reboot to take effect.

Perform the BIOS update from the BIOS Boot Menu, independent of the installed operating system
1. Copy the downloaded file to a USB flash device. The flash device does not need to be bootable.
2. Insert the USB flash device into any USB port.
3. Power on the system.
4. At the Dell logo screen, press F12 to access the one-time boot menu.
5. Select "BIOS Flash Update" in the "Other Options" section.
6. Click on the "..." button to browse the USB flash device to locate the downloaded file.
7. Select the file and click "Ok"
8. Confirm the Existing System BIOS Information and the BIOS Update Information are as expected.
9. Click "Begin Flash Update"
10. Review the warning message and click "Yes" to proceed with the update.
11. The system should restart and show a Flash Progress bar on the Dell logo screen as the BIOS update is being performed.
12. The system will restart once again when the Flash update is complete.
